PARAMEDICS rescued a terrified elderly woman after she had accidentally reversed her car into a river, where it overturned - trapping her inside.

The women, who is in her late 60s, sounded her horn to attract the attention of members of the public, who then called the emergency services to come to the rescue.

After an ambulance arrived on the scene, a paramedic waded into the River Frome, beside Linton Mobile Home Park, in Bromyard, and managed to release the woman.

She was taken to the Hereford County Hospital for treatment, but was not seriously injured.

The incident took place on Sunday just after 8.30pm.

A spokeswoman for Hereford and Worcester NHS Ambulance Service Trust said: "The lady in the car was very frightened, and we are delighted that the quick-thinking and bravery of our staff meant that she was released very quickly.
